To begin, it’s important to understand the basic components of an alarm system. Most alarm systems consist of sensors, control panels, sirens, and wiring that connects each of these components together. The wiring serves as the backbone of the system, transmitting signals between the sensors and the control panel to trigger the alarm when an intrusion is detected. By examining a disabled alarm wiring diagram, you can identify the different wires and connections that need to be modified or removed to disable the system.
One of the first steps in disabling an alarm system is locating the control panel. This is usually mounted on a wall or hidden in a closet and contains the circuitry that controls the entire alarm system. Once you have located the control panel, you can open it up to access the wiring diagram. This diagram will show you which wires are connected to which components, allowing you to trace the connections and determine how to disable the system.
When looking at a disabled alarm wiring diagram, you will typically see different colored wires representing various components of the alarm system. For instance, red wires are often used for power connections, while black wires are typically used for ground connections. By following the wiring diagram and disconnecting the appropriate wires, you can effectively disable the alarm system without causing any damage to the existing wiring or components.
To disable an alarm system, you will need to first turn off the power to the control panel to prevent any electrical shocks or malfunctions. Once the power is off, you can begin disconnecting the wires according to the wiring diagram. This may involve cutting wires, unscrewing connections, or simply pulling plugs from their sockets. It’s crucial to follow the wiring diagram closely to ensure that you disable the system correctly and safely.
After disconnecting the wires, you may need to remove any sensors or sirens that are still active. This can be done by unscrewing the components from their mounts and disconnecting any remaining wires. Once all of the components have been removed and the wires have been safely disconnected, you can test the system to ensure that it has been successfully disabled.
